Abstract

A single free-running dual-comb MIXSEL is used to perform dual-comb spectroscopy on water vapour and acetylene. This ulrafast laser technology is based on passively modelocked optically pumped semiconductor lasers. This is a paradigm shift in dual-comb generation.
